Thomas Alva Edison (February 11, 1847 October 18, 1931) was an American inventor and entrepreneur, who invented many things. Thomas Edison developed one of the first practical light bulbs, but contrary to popular belief did not invent the light bulb. Edison s 1093 patents were the most granted to any inventor in his time. Thomas Edison Wikipedia Thomas Alva Edison (February 11, 1847 – October 18, 1931) was an American inventor and businessman who has been described as America s greatest inventor. He developed many devices in fields such as electric power generation, mass communication, sound recording, and motion pictures.
